<http://forums.realsoftware.com/viewtopic.php?t=47839> Page 1 of 1 [ 4 posts ] Previous topic | Next topic Author Message WolfB Post subject: String <> String?Posted: Fri May 10, 2013 12:43 am Joined: Sat Nov 03, 2012 5:34 am Posts: 14 Hello all, I have tried this simple code: Dim s As String s=chr(&hFE)+ chr(&hFE)+ chr(&h76) + chr(&hE0)+ chr(&h03)+ chr(&hFD) Should give a binary chain of "FE FE 76 EO 03 FD". In REAL Studio 2011 Release 4.2 is does so. In Real Studi0 2012 Release I receive "C3 BE C3 BE 79 C3 A0 03 C3 BD". Well, this looks like UDF-8 coding, but why??? Any ideas? Top timhare Post subject: Re: String <> String?Posted: Fri May 10, 2013 2:05 am Joined: Fri Jan 06, 2006 3:21 pm Posts: 12311 Location: Portland, OR USA Chr() has always supposed to be UTF-8, but it made an exception for values from 128-255, where it functioned like ChrB(). They corrected that bug. Use ChrB() instead. Or Encodings.ASCII.Chr().
